日期:2014-05-17  浏览次数:20853 次

判断文本框不为空时显示下拉框
判断文本框(<input type="text" name="BQ" size="13">)
不为空时显示下拉框(<select size="1" name="XZ"><option checked>-请选择-</option>)

请用在页面

以下是我的写法,但有问题,请指点!
<html>
<head>
<script type="text/javascript">
function load()
if (document.getElementById("BQ").value == "")
{
  document.getElementById( "XZ").disabled=true; 
}
</script>
</head>

<body onload="load()">
<input type="text" name="BQ" size="13">
<select size="1" name="XZ"><option checked>选择</option><select>
</body>
</html>


------解决方案--------------------
JScript code

document.getElementsByName('COLTD')[0].onblur = function(){
    if(this.value != ""){
        document.getElementsByName('YWNAME')[0].style.display = "block";
    } else {
        document.getElementsByName('YWNAME')[0].style.display = "none";
    }
};

------解决方案--------------------
其实,加上ID是有习惯来的。

<html>
<head>
<script type="text/javascript">
function load()
{
if (document.getElementById("BQ").value == "")
{
document.getElementById( "XZ").disabled=true;
}
}
</script>
</head>

<body onload="load()">
<input type="text" name="BQ" size="13">
<select size="1" name="XZ"><option checked>选择</option><select>
</body>
</html>